invalid+suffix+n+on

作者&投稿:单于居 (若有异议请与网页底部的电邮联系)

才旦欧19431132311问: C语言报错invalid suffix n on integer constant -
安阳县麻芩回答: 数学表达式不能全部直接应用到C语言:2n改成2*n

才旦欧19431132311问: 为什么运行会出现error invalid suffix n on integer constant -
安阳县麻芩回答: #include<stdio.h> main() { int x,y; scanf("%d",&x); if (x<1) y=x; else if (x>=1&&x<10) y=2*x-1; else y=3*x-11; printf("%d\n",y); return 0; } 表达式出错了2x!=2*x

才旦欧19431132311问: 为什么print显示invalid syntax啊? -
安阳县麻芩回答: def fact(n):s=1 for i in range(2,n+1):s*=i return s k=eval(input("请输入一个数:"))#此处少一个括号 print("该数的阶乘值为{}".format(fact(k))),

才旦欧19431132311问: invalid suffix "n" on integer constant 什么意思 ? -
安阳县麻芩回答: 因为你将一个整数写成了"123n"的形式,把"n"去掉就行了.

才旦欧19431132311问: C编译完出现2.c:10:5: invalid suffix "x" on floating constant -
安阳县麻芩回答: y=0.53x; 改为 y=0.53*x;

才旦欧19431132311问: error: invalid suffix "ndNumber" on integer constant -
安阳县麻芩回答: 变量定义不要用数字打头,1stNumber这样的不符合C规范,把1和2去掉就行了

才旦欧19431132311问: 关于(invalid suffix "b00001100" on integer constant)类似的编译错误 -
安阳县麻芩回答: 0b代表二进制?编译器不认识吧! 编译器只认识以下三种: 0x开头:16进制 0开头:8进制 无前导:10进制只能换作十六进制了,要么你自己写个函数

才旦欧19431132311问: Python初学,2.7.3.总是有invalidsyntax问题,如图.按F5就出提示. -
安阳县麻芩回答: 在交互式命令行下运行命令不用按F5,直接回车就能执行.如果要输入一个程序,按下CTRL+N,会有一个新窗口,在那个窗口输入代码,按F5保存执行

才旦欧19431132311问: 格式化C盘后无法启动电脑,屏幕显示:INVALID SYSTEM DISK REPLACE THE DISK,AND THEN PRESS ANY KEY -
安阳县麻芩回答: http://zhidao.baidu.com/q?word=INVALID+SYSTEM+DISK+REPLACE+THE+DISK%A3%ACAND+THEN+PRESS+ANY+KEY&ct=17&pn=0&tn=ikaslist&rn=10

才旦欧19431132311问: gnu汇编 Error: suffix or operands invalid for *** -
安阳县麻芩回答: 有两种可能1、pop/push指令没选对.Linux下的as命令来自 GNU binutils,用的是AT&T汇编语法.根据操作数大小的不同,压栈时应选择push、pushw、pushl、pushq中需要的指令,而不是像Intel汇编那样不管什么东西,全用push来做.pop指令同样存在类似的popw、popl、popq指令.2、操作数是不是有问题(AT&T汇编下的表示法和Intel汇编有差别,比如用$来引立即数,这个很可能是你遇到错误的原因).要么去用支持Intel汇编语法的汇编程序(如nasm),要么学一下AT&T汇编(如果真打算在Linux下干活,建议学AT&T汇编).


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网